Legal Last Will and Testament Form for Single Person with Adult Children Oregon
What is the Legal Last Will And Testament Form For Single Person With Adult Children Oregon
The Legal Last Will And Testament Form for a single person with adult children in Oregon is a crucial legal document that outlines how an individual's assets and affairs will be managed after their passing. This form allows the testator, the person creating the will, to specify their wishes regarding the distribution of their property, guardianship of dependents, and other important matters. In Oregon, this form must comply with state laws to ensure its validity and enforceability.
How to Use the Legal Last Will And Testament Form For Single Person With Adult Children Oregon
Using the Legal Last Will And Testament Form involves several key steps. First, the testator should gather all necessary information about their assets, debts, and beneficiaries. Next, they can fill out the form, ensuring that all required sections are completed accurately. Once the form is filled out, it must be signed in the presence of at least two witnesses who are not beneficiaries. This step is essential for the will to be legally binding in Oregon.
Steps to Complete the Legal Last Will And Testament Form For Single Person With Adult Children Oregon
Completing the Legal Last Will And Testament Form involves a series of straightforward steps:
- Gather personal information, including full names and addresses of beneficiaries.
- List all assets and specify how they should be distributed.
- Designate an executor who will manage the estate.
- Include any specific instructions for guardianship if applicable.
- Review the form for accuracy and completeness.
- Sign the will in the presence of two witnesses.
- Store the will in a safe place and inform trusted individuals of its location.
Key Elements of the Legal Last Will And Testament Form For Single Person With Adult Children Oregon
Key elements of the Legal Last Will And Testament Form include:
- Testator Information: Full name and address of the person creating the will.
- Beneficiaries: Names and relationships of individuals receiving assets.
- Asset Distribution: Detailed instructions on how property and assets should be divided.
- Executor Designation: Appointment of an executor to carry out the will's instructions.
- Witness Signatures: Signatures from at least two witnesses to validate the will.
State-Specific Rules for the Legal Last Will And Testament Form For Single Person With Adult Children Oregon
Oregon has specific rules governing the creation and execution of wills. The testator must be at least eighteen years old and of sound mind. The will must be in writing, and it can be handwritten or typed. Oregon does not require notarization, but having a notary can simplify the probate process. Additionally, the witnesses must be at least eighteen years old and cannot be beneficiaries of the will to avoid conflicts of interest.
Legal Use of the Legal Last Will And Testament Form For Single Person With Adult Children Oregon
The Legal Last Will And Testament Form serves as a legally binding document that directs how an individual's estate will be handled after death. It ensures that the testator's wishes are honored and provides clarity to beneficiaries and the executor. In Oregon, a properly executed will can help avoid disputes among family members and streamline the probate process, making it essential for individuals to have an up-to-date will in place.
